终极免费模组管理器:RimSort帮你3步解决RimWorld模组冲突难题
终极免费模组管理器:RimSort帮你3步解决RimWorld模组冲突难题
【免费下载链接】RimSortRimSort is an open source mod manager for the video game RimWorld. There is support for Linux, Mac, and Windows, built from the ground up to be a reliable, community-managed alternative to RimPy Mod Manager.项目地址: https://gitcode.com/gh_mirrors/ri/RimSort
还在为RimWorld模组冲突而头疼吗?面对上百个模组的手动管理,是否让你感到力不从心?RimSort——这款开源的跨平台模组管理器,正是为你量身打造的解决方案!无论是Windows、macOS还是Linux用户,都能享受到它带来的极致便利。这款RimWorld模组管理器采用智能排序算法,彻底告别游戏崩溃的烦恼,让你专注于殖民地的建设与发展。
为什么你需要RimSort模组管理器?
传统的手动管理模组方式存在诸多痛点:模组冲突导致游戏崩溃、加载顺序混乱、依赖缺失难以排查、模组更新混乱……RimSort通过智能排序算法和实时冲突检测,将这些烦恼一扫而空!
手动管理 vs RimSort智能管理
| 对比项 | 手动管理 | RimSort智能管理 |
|---|---|---|
| 时间消耗 | 每次添加新模组需30分钟检查 | 点击几下,瞬间完成 |
| 错误率 | 依赖关系复杂,错误率超40% | 智能算法,几乎零错误 |
| 排查难度 | 游戏崩溃后需逐一手动测试 | 实时检测,精准定位问题 |
| 配置同步 | 重装系统后需重新设置 | 一键导出导入,配置永不丢失 |
快速上手:3步开启智能模组管理之旅
第一步:获取与安装RimSort
最简单的获取方式是从GitCode克隆仓库:
git clone https://gitcode.com/gh_mirrors/ri/RimSort cd RimSortWindows用户可以直接下载预编译的可执行文件,Linux和macOS用户按照官方指南安装依赖即可。整个安装过程不超过5分钟!
第二步:初始配置与路径检测
首次启动RimSort,它会自动检测你的RimWorld游戏安装位置。如果你使用Steam Workshop模组,简单几步即可完成Steam集成配置。最关键的步骤是构建模组数据库——RimSort会扫描所有模组并建立智能索引。
第三步:享受智能模组管理
配置完成后,RimSort的界面设计直观高效:
- 左侧面板:显示所有可用模组(已安装但未激活)
- 右侧面板:显示当前激活的模组列表
- 拖放操作:像整理文件夹一样简单
- 智能搜索:输入关键词,快速找到特定模组
RimSort的五大核心功能亮点
1. 智能拓扑排序算法
RimSort的核心是先进的拓扑排序算法。它会读取每个模组的About.xml文件,解析loadBefore、loadAfter和loadOrder标签,构建完整的依赖关系图。当检测到循环依赖时,系统使用NetworkX库分析依赖图,找出具体的循环路径并提示用户解决。
2. 实时冲突检测系统
添加或激活模组时,RimSort会实时检查潜在问题:
- 缺失依赖检测:自动识别缺少的前置模组,一键下载
- 版本兼容性检查:确保模组与当前游戏版本匹配
- 不兼容模组预警:标记已知的不兼容组合,避免游戏崩溃
3. 规则编辑器完全掌控
对于高级用户,RimSort提供了精细的规则编辑器。你可以自定义模组加载优先级、创建复杂的依赖规则、锁定特定模组的位置,并导入/导出规则配置。
4. Steam Workshop深度集成
通过SteamCMD集成,RimSort可以直接从Steam Workshop下载和更新模组:
- 批量下载模组:无需逐个点击订阅,节省90%时间
- 离线管理:即使Steam客户端未运行也能管理模组
- 自动更新:保持模组版本最新,无需手动检查
5. 纹理优化与性能提升
RimSort集成了DDS编码器(todds),可以自动优化模组纹理,减少内存占用,提升游戏加载速度,改善游戏运行性能。
四个真实用户场景:RimSort如何改变游戏体验
场景一:新玩家的完美入门
小李刚接触RimWorld模组,面对数百个选择不知所措。RimSort的"推荐模组"功能帮助他快速构建基础模组组合,智能排序确保所有模组正常运行,让他专注于游戏乐趣而非技术问题。
场景二:资深玩家的模组迁移
老王有300+模组,每次游戏更新都是噩梦。RimSort自动检测与当前游戏版本不兼容的模组,提示可用更新版本,帮助他在更新期间保持模组配置稳定。
场景三:多人联机的配置同步
几个朋友想一起玩模组联机,但每个人的模组配置都不同。通过RimSort的导出功能,队长将完美配置分享给队友,大家一键导入,自动下载缺失模组,5分钟完成同步。
场景四:崩溃问题的快速诊断
小张的游戏突然崩溃,传统方法需要逐一手动禁用模组测试。RimSort的日志分析功能自动分析崩溃原因,精准定位问题模组,并提供解决方案建议。
技术架构:三层智能保障体系
RimSort使用多层数据库架构确保数据准确:
- 本地数据库:存储已安装模组的元数据
- 社区数据库:共享的模组兼容性信息,持续更新
- 用户规则:个性化的加载顺序规则,满足特殊需求
源码路径:app/ 中包含了完整的实现逻辑,从控制器到模型再到工具类,架构清晰可维护。
七个高效使用技巧
1. 定期更新数据库
建议每周运行一次"更新数据库"操作,获取最新的社区规则和模组兼容性信息。
2. 使用模组分组管理
将功能相关的模组分组管理,例如:生活质量改进组、图形增强组、新内容扩展组、平衡性调整组。
3. 备份你的配置
在重大游戏更新或大量添加新模组前,导出当前配置。这样如果出现问题,可以快速恢复到稳定状态。
4. 参与社区贡献
RimSort是开源项目,社区贡献是它持续改进的动力。如果你发现某个模组的兼容性信息不准确,可以通过规则编辑器提交修正。
5. 利用批量操作功能
当需要启用/禁用多个相关模组时,使用批量选择功能,而不是逐个操作。
6. 关注性能监控
RimSort会显示每个模组的大致性能影响,帮助你优化模组组合。
7. 学习使用快捷键
掌握几个关键快捷键,如Ctrl+A全选、Ctrl+D反选等,大幅提升操作效率。
常见问题解答
RimSort会影响游戏性能吗?
不会。RimSort只在游戏启动前运行,用于配置模组加载顺序。它不会在游戏运行时占用任何资源。
我需要一直保持RimSort运行吗?
不需要。只有在需要更改模组配置时才需要运行RimSort。配置完成后,你可以关闭程序,游戏会使用保存的配置启动。
RimSort安全吗?
RimSort是完全开源的,代码透明可审计。它不会修改游戏文件,只管理模组的加载顺序和配置。
支持哪些操作系统?
RimSort原生支持Windows、macOS和Linux。无论你使用什么平台,都能获得相同的功能和体验。
需要付费吗?
完全免费!RimSort是开源项目,由社区维护,没有任何付费功能或订阅。
如何报告问题或建议功能?
可以通过项目的GitCode页面提交问题或功能请求,开发团队会及时响应。
开始你的模组管理革命
RimWorld的模组系统是其长久生命力的关键,但复杂的管理往往让玩家望而却步。RimSort通过自动化、智能化的管理工具,让你能够专注于游戏本身,而不是模组配置的繁琐细节。
无论你是刚刚开始接触模组的新手,还是管理着数百个模组的老玩家,RimSort都能显著提升你的游戏体验。从今天开始,告别模组冲突的烦恼,享受顺畅的RimWorld模组管理体验!
记住,最好的工具是那些让你几乎感觉不到它们存在的工具。RimSort正是这样的工具——它默默地在后台工作,确保你的模组配置始终处于最佳状态,让你能够完全沉浸在RimWorld的殖民世界中。
官方文档:docs/ 提供了详细的用户指南和开发文档,帮助你更好地使用这款强大的模组管理器。
【免费下载链接】RimSortRimSort is an open source mod manager for the video game RimWorld. There is support for Linux, Mac, and Windows, built from the ground up to be a reliable, community-managed alternative to RimPy Mod Manager.项目地址: https://gitcode.com/gh_mirrors/ri/RimSort
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
